By … WebJul 14, 2024 · Party Games. Games were a central point for many of the parties in the 1930’s. Card games like rummy, bridge and pinochle were fast favorites, as were stand-up games such as Charades. Board games were also booming in the 1930s, such as Monopoly, Sorry and Scrabble. Keep in mind Prohibition, and how gambling was a part of the scene.
